I've fought on the battlefields, survived catastrophic injury, and rebuilt myself from the ground up-not just physically, but mentally and spiritually.

You don't have to take shrapnel to feel shattered.

We all end up in a fight we didn't ask for-maybe it's loss, failure, addiction, injury, or just the slow grind of trying to keep it together when life hits hard. Alone in the Platoon Space is my story of being blown apart-literally-and clawing my way back. But it's not just about combat. It's about pain, grit, and choosing not to quit when no one's watching. If you're in the middle of your own battle, or trying to make sense of the wreckage afterward, you're not alone.
